Went tonight, my thoughts, FWIW.
The dual ordering line is untenable, unless you want to stand in line twice for your food. If you have multiple people on the same tab, I'm not sure how well that will work. Settled on tacos only, to solve the dual line dilemma. Duck confit was flavorless. Shrimp was horribly over cooked and rubbery. Oxtail was great. Tacos were small and pricy. 3 tacos, a side of beans and chips w/ queso were $30. 3 tacos for 2 people came out on the same taco holder. Not sure if you can request an additional plate or not. Chips and queso were good as previously mentioned. At the checkout, I inquired as to cocktails, was told to order at the bar. The bar was deep with people, fortunately our "server" was available. No cocktail menu, just some notes she had scribbled on a piece of paper. 2 tap handles, Pacifico and an Anthem product. Bottles? Yeah, I think so but not sure what. What cocktails do you have? Any specialties? Just some meaningless descriptions with no knowledge of ingredients, serving manner, price, etc.
There are some curious decisions regarding the layout of the place, especially with regard to the dual opposing pairs of garage doors, but I'm not a restaurant designer, so what do I know.
Wish them well; won't be back anytime soon.
